Analysis
The most recent figure for repetition rate in primary education (all grades), male in Paraguay is 5.5%, measured in 2011.
That represents a change of up 0.8% on the previous year and down 37.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, repetition rate in primary education (all grades), male in Paraguay peaked at 19.3% in 1972 and was at its lowest, 4.7%, in 2006.
That places Paraguay 58th out of 181 countries with data for 2011,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 39 years of available data.

About this data
Number of male repeaters in primary education in a given school year, expressed as a percentage of male enrolment in primary education in the previous school year. Divide the number of male repeaters in primary education in school year t+1 by the number of male pupils from the same cohort enrolled in primary education in the previous school year t.
